Transmitter power is limited to 4 watts in the US and the EU. CB radios have a range of about 3 miles (4.8 km) to 20 miles (32 km) depending on terrain, for line of sight communication; however, various radio propagation conditions may intermittently allow communication over much greater distances.How many watts should my CB antenna be?

Why is CB limited to 4 watts?
The FCC allows a maximum of 4 watts of output power for CB radios to avoid signal interference with other devices, such as TV and emergency communication radios.What does Delta Tune do on a CB?
The delta tune is the CB name for a very similar function on amateur radios called RIT, or receive incremental tuner. The Delta Tune controls the frequency your radio's receiver is operating on.What setting should my CB radio be on?
